Is it good to replace an inefficient water heater?
In fact, it often makes sense to replace an inefficient water heater even if it’s in good shape. The energy savings alone could pay for the new water heater after just a few years, and you’ll be happy knowing that you are dumping fewer pollutants into the air and less money down the drain.

What was the last tank to come out of the Soviet Union?
The T-80 was the last main battle tank to come out of the Soviet Union. It was the first Soviet tank to mount a gas turbine engine, giving it a top road speed of 70 kilometers per hour and an efficient power-to-weight ratio of 25.8 horsepower per ton. This made the standard T-80B one of the most nimble tanks to come out of the 1980s.

How does a hydropneumatic tank provide efficient water supply?
In order to provide efficient water supply, hydropneumatic tanks regulate system pressures to quickly meet system demand. The compressed air creates a cushion that can absorb or apply pressure as needed. Air that is reabsorbed into the system water is sometimes replenished with the addition of a small air compressor.
What should I do when I need to replace my toilet tank?
When you need to replace the tank, drain and unscrew the old one to remove it. After getting your new tank, put in the hardware to waterproof it and then secure it in place. Once the tank fills up with water, you can use your toilet again!
